For project managers and site leads outfitting hotels, resorts, terraces, or mixed-use developments, choosing modular outdoor rattan furniture is not just about style—it is about lifecycle value, weather resistance, and maintenance efficiency. In commercial spaces where heavy use is constant, understanding which materials, frame constructions, and modular designs last best can reduce replacement costs and support long-term project performance.
In hospitality and public-use projects, modular outdoor rattan furniture faces far harsher conditions than it does in residential patios. Daily guest turnover, housekeeping movement, UV exposure, rain cycles, food spills, and frequent reconfiguration all accelerate wear.
That is why project teams cannot evaluate outdoor woven seating on appearance alone. The long-term result depends on the polymer used in the weave, the metal or wood inside the frame, the fastening method, the cushion construction, and the supplier’s ability to maintain consistency across batches.
For commercial buyers, durability means more than surviving one season. It means retaining structural integrity, color stability, cleaning efficiency, and layout flexibility over repeated use cycles. This is especially important when furniture must match phased openings or replacement programs across multiple properties.
The best-performing modular outdoor rattan furniture for commercial use usually combines synthetic rattan with corrosion-resistant frames. Natural rattan may look warm and artisanal, but it is generally not the first choice for exposed commercial settings because moisture and UV can shorten its service life.
High-density polyethylene and similar engineered outdoor fibers are widely preferred because they resist cracking, fading, and moisture better than natural cane. Their flexibility also helps the weave absorb use without snapping as quickly in busy lounge or poolside environments.
Many premature failures in modular outdoor rattan furniture come from hidden frames, not the visible weave. Powder-coated aluminum is usually the most practical option for commercial spaces because it balances corrosion resistance, lower weight, and operational ease during layout changes.
Steel can deliver high strength, but in coastal or humid areas it requires tighter control of coating quality and weld finishing. Teak or other hardwood accents may suit design-led properties, but they add maintenance expectations that not every operations team wants to manage.

For most commercial programs, synthetic weave over aluminum offers the safest balance of life expectancy, maintenance control, and installation practicality. Buyers should still request construction details, because similar-looking products can perform very differently in service.
When teams compare modular outdoor rattan furniture, the visible style often gets more attention than the engineering. Yet the most reliable sets usually share several hidden strengths: reinforced joints, consistent welding, replaceable feet, stable linking systems, and cushions designed for drainage and quick drying.
A truly modular system is useful because it helps teams adapt to occupancy changes, event layouts, phased fit-outs, and future replacements. If a corner unit can be replaced independently, a damaged section does not force full-set disposal. That directly protects budget and reduces downtime.
Project leaders should also assess whether spare parts, matching cushions, and repeat orders are realistic. In global sourcing, supply continuity matters almost as much as first delivery. The same modular outdoor rattan furniture will not perform equally across all commercial environments. Coastal chlorides, rooftop wind, pool chemicals, and mountain UV intensity each create different failure points. A site-based comparison improves procurement decisions.

This comparison shows why one specification rarely fits every site. Project teams that define environmental exposure early tend to avoid costly mid-cycle replacements and rushed substitution orders later.
A strong buying process for modular outdoor rattan furniture should convert design intent into measurable requirements. Too many commercial orders still rely on showroom impressions or sample approval without enough attention to repeatability, maintenance needs, and logistics.

The cheapest modular outdoor rattan furniture is often the most expensive choice over a multi-year operating period. Commercial value comes from balancing acquisition cost with labor hours, cleaning demands, replacement frequency, and the risk of visual inconsistency after partial replenishment.
A practical commercial strategy is to standardize a limited modular family across similar zones. That approach simplifies spare planning, training, and reorder management. It also gives finance teams a clearer replacement roadmap instead of unpredictable emergency purchases.
Commercial furniture buyers often need more than a visual specification. Depending on the project and region, internal approval may require evidence related to material safety, durability, or responsible sourcing. Requirements differ, but the review process should be structured.
The key point is not to assume that every claim carries the same meaning. Procurement managers should ask how performance is defined, what documentation exists, and whether the supplied sample truly represents bulk production. A polished sample may hide weak internal construction. Always connect aesthetic approval with technical confirmation, especially for frame composition, drainage design, and modular connectors.
If cushions are slow to dry or covers are difficult to remove, operations teams absorb the problem. Maintenance friction eventually becomes a budget issue.
Highly customized sectional layouts can look impressive during opening, but they may complicate future replenishment. Standardized module logic often serves commercial projects better over time.
Furniture suitable for a shaded courtyard may fail quickly on a rooftop or beachfront. Site-specific exposure must guide the final selection.
Service life depends on climate, use intensity, maintenance, and specification quality. In practice, the difference between a short-lived and a durable solution often comes down to frame protection, UV stability, drainage, and whether parts can be replaced instead of discarding whole sets.
It can work in sheltered semi-outdoor zones, but exposed commercial applications usually favor synthetic outdoor weave. For hotels, terraces, and pool environments, engineered materials are generally the safer lifecycle choice.
Both matter, but commercial failures often begin in the frame, joints, feet, or hardware. A strong-looking weave cannot compensate for internal corrosion or unstable structural design.
Use a modular family with shared dimensions and interchangeable sections across multiple zones. That makes future expansion, phased delivery, and replacement easier while preserving visual consistency.
